汇编语言程序设计实验指导及习题解答-第五章.pdfVIP

  • 9
  • 0
  • 约3.61万字
  • 约 23页
  • 2017-04-27 发布于浙江
  • 举报

汇编语言程序设计实验指导及习题解答-第五章.pdf

汇编语言程序设计实验指导及习题解答-第五章

第 5 章 子程序及宏指令设计 子程序及宏指令是汇编语言程序设计中的重要内容,可以简化程序结构,实现程序的 模块化,提高汇编语言程序设计的质量和效率。本章主要介绍了子程序的定义、子程序的 调用和返回、子程序的参数传递方法以及宏汇编中最具特色的部分:宏指令、重复汇编与 条件汇编,并结合具体实例,讨论了子程序和宏指令的程序设计方法及技巧。 5.1 子程序设计方法 子程序是程序设计的基本概念。实际编程时,常把功能相对独立的程序段单独编写和 调试,作为一个相对独立的模块供程序使用,这就是子程序,亦称过程,相当于高级语言 中的过程和函数,调用子程序的程序称为主程序(或称为调用程序)。 5.1.1 子程序定义 子程序的定义是由一对过程定义伪指令 PROC 和 ENDP 来完成的,其一般格式如下: 子程序名 PROC[NEAR∣FAR] [保护现场] 子程序体 [恢复现场] RET 子程序名 ENDP 对子程序定义的具体规定如下:

文档评论(0)

1亿VIP精品文档

相关文档